USA Ingredients Water Market Overview:
The USA ingredient water market is a critical component of industrial production, with applications in food, beverage, pharmaceutical, and personal care industries. In 2024, the market exceeded US* ** billion, driven by demand for ultra-pure and treated water. U.S. manufacturers are known for setting global benchmarks in water quality, leveraging advanced purification methods like reverse osmosis, UV, and deionization. The domestic market is largely self-sufficient, with increasing export volumes valued at over US$ ** million, while imports of premium specialty waters reached US$ ** million. High regulatory standards from the FDA and EPA shape market operations and global credibility.

Market Growth Factors
Growth is primarily fueled by expanding applications in health-oriented beverages, clean-label cosmetic formulations, and pharmaceutical manufacturing. Between 2025 and 2030, a projected CAGR of **% is expected, supported by rising consumption of fortified drinks and sterile injectables. Technological advances in water treatment systems and stricter regulatory compliance are pushing demand for higher purity levels. Additionally, sustainability-focused practices such as on-site purification and water recycling are increasingly adopted by U.S. manufacturers seeking cost efficiency and environmental compliance.

Market Restraints & Challenges
Despite its strong performance, the market faces challenges including high infrastructure costs for setting up treatment systems, volatile energy prices, and region-specific water scarcity concerns. Smaller firms may struggle with regulatory compliance due to the technical complexity of water quality monitoring. Global competition in bulk or low-purity ingredient water segments also limits U.S. price-setting capability, with developing nations offering cheaper alternatives for less regulated applications.

Market Segmentation
The market is segmented by application, treatment type, and delivery format. Food and beverage industries account for over **% of usage, followed by pharmaceuticals at **%, and cosmetics at **%. By treatment, reverse osmosis and UV-purified water dominate, while distilled and deionized waters are key in pharmaceutical and cosmetic segments. Ingredient water is delivered via on-site treatment systems or bulk delivery; large enterprises prefer in-house systems, while SMEs rely on external suppliers. Specialty and functional waters—such as those enriched with minerals—are also gaining traction in premium product lines.

Competitive Landscape
The market is moderately consolidated with global giants like PepsiCo, Nestlé Waters, and The Coca-Cola Company operating integrated systems to control quality and reduce costs. Pharma leaders such as Pfizer and Johnson & Johnson rely on ultra-pure water produced through in-house systems aligned with USP standards. Equipment suppliers like Evoqua and Culligan support mid-sized firms by offering modular purification solutions. Innovation and sustainability drive competition, with newer entrants focusing on smart filtration, energy savings, and closed-loop systems to address rising environmental expectations and ensure regulatory compliance.
